Feature Comparison

Fallom

Real-Time Observability

Fallom delivers real-time observability for AI agents, allowing teams to track tool calls, analyze timing, and debug issues confidently. With a live dashboard, organizations can monitor every LLM call and gain insights into performance metrics, ensuring optimal operation of AI systems.

Cost Attribution

With Fallom, organizations can track spending per model, user, and team, providing full cost transparency for budgeting and chargeback purposes. This feature allows businesses to optimize their AI expenditures and make informed decisions about resource allocation.

Compliance and Audit Trails

Fallom ensures regulatory compliance with complete audit trails that support requirements such as the EU AI Act, SOC 2, and GDPR. Organizations can maintain detailed records of input/output logging, model versioning, and user consent tracking, ensuring they are prepared for audits and regulatory scrutiny.

Timing Waterfall Analysis

Fallom's timing waterfall feature allows teams to debug latency issues in complex workflows. By visualizing the timing of each step in multi-step agent processes, users can identify bottlenecks and improve the efficiency of their LLM interactions.

qtrl.ai

Autonomous QA Agents

qtrl.ai's autonomous QA agents execute testing instructions either on demand or continuously, ensuring flexibility in testing cycles. These agents can operate at scale across multiple environments while adhering to user-defined rules, providing real browser execution instead of mere simulations for reliable results.

Enterprise-Grade Test Management

With qtrl.ai, teams benefit from centralized management of test cases, plans, and runs. This feature includes full traceability and audit trails, enabling both manual and automated workflows that are designed to meet compliance and audit requirements seamlessly.

Progressive Automation

Users can initiate testing with human-written instructions and progressively transition to AI-generated tests when they are ready. qtrl.ai further enhances this process by suggesting new tests based on coverage gaps, ensuring teams can continuously improve their testing strategies.

Adaptive Memory

The adaptive memory feature builds a living knowledge base of the application, learning from exploration, test execution, and identified issues. This capability powers smarter, context-aware test generation that becomes more effective with each interaction, enhancing overall testing efficiency.

Overview

About Fallom

Fallom is a revolutionary AI-native observability platform meticulously crafted to cater to the needs of organizations leveraging large language model (LLM) and agent workloads. It empowers teams with unparalleled visibility into every LLM interaction in production, ensuring comprehensive end-to-end tracing that encompasses prompts, outputs, tool calls, tokens, latency, and per-call costs. Designed for teams aiming to optimize their AI operations, Fallom provides rich user, session, and customer-level context alongside detailed timing waterfalls for intricate, multi-step agents. With robust enterprise-grade compliance features, including meticulous audit trails for logging, model versioning, and consent tracking, Fallom emerges as an essential tool for businesses navigating complex regulatory landscapes. Its OpenTelemetry-native SDK allows teams to rapidly instrument their applications, enabling real-time monitoring of usage, confident debugging of issues, and efficient cost attribution across various models, users, and teams—achieved in mere minutes.

About qtrl.ai

qtrl.ai is an innovative QA platform that empowers software teams to enhance their quality assurance processes without sacrificing oversight or governance. Tailored for product-led engineering teams, QA departments transitioning from manual to automated testing, and enterprises with stringent compliance requirements, qtrl.ai seamlessly integrates enterprise-grade test management with advanced AI-driven automation. Its central hub allows teams to organize test cases, plan test runs, trace requirements, and monitor quality metrics through dynamic, real-time dashboards. This structured environment ensures complete transparency regarding testing coverage, pass rates, and potential risks. Unlike traditional automation tools that often complicate processes, qtrl.ai introduces intelligent automation incrementally, allowing teams to start with straightforward manual testing and scale to autonomous agents that generate and maintain UI tests from plain English descriptions. Ultimately, qtrl.ai bridges the gap between the slow, meticulous nature of manual testing and the complexities of traditional automation, ensuring a trusted pathway to faster and smarter quality assurance.
